Days Of Our Lives Spoilers: Former Johnny DiMera Carson Boatman Wants To Try His Hand At ABC’s General Hospital

Days of Our Lives spoilers and updates reveal Carson Boatman (Johnny DiMera) wants to try his hand at ABC’s General Hospital.

And he isn’t the first DOOL alum to move from Salem to Port Charles if he’s offered a role on the ABC soap!

Carson Was One Of Several To Get The Axe At The NBC Peacock Soap

The former star of Days of our Lives concluded his portrayal of Johnny DiMera, the son of EJ DiMera (Dan Feuerriegel) and Sami Brady (Alison Sweeney), in early 2026.

He was one of four to get the axe, but  will continue to be featured on the Peacock streaming service until the end of this year or early 2027.

He expressed his reflections on leaving the show and his aspirations for the future during a stop on the Day Players tour in New Jersey.

The Day Players band includes Boatman, Scott Reeves (formerly of DAYS, GH, Y&R), Brandon Barash (formerly of DAYS, GH), and Eric Martsolf (currently playing Brady Black on DAYS). Fans can catch the group performing on the East Coast this coming April and May.

Carson Is Focusing On His Music Career Currently

Currently, Carson is concentrating on his music career, particularly after the release of his latest single, “Wild Thing.”

However, he hints that another soap opera role isn’t off the table. “I would love to make a leap to GH as well. I’m completely open to experiencing life in Port Charles,” Boatman shared.

If GH were to reach out, it could be a great opportunity for the talented actor, singer, and songwriter.

A former Days Of Our Lives star moving from Salem to Port Charles is certainly a possibility, as the two long-standing soap operas have a history of exchanging cast members.

Two In The Band Were On Both Soaps

There are two in the band and one still on  DOOL, although Scott Reeves (Jake Hoganson) and Brandon Barash (Stefan DiMera, Jake DiMera) are not currently on any soap.

Wally Kurth currently plays both Ned Quartermaine on General Hospital and Justin Kiriakis on Days of Our Lives, the nearly-year ahead filming schedule of DOOL making it possible to play both roles.

The departing Wes Ramsey, who reprised his role of Owen Kent recently, also played Peter August for several years on the ABC soap.

Steve Burton, who reprised his role as Harris Michaels, returned to playing  Jason Morgan on General Hospital.

Other DOOL actors who have migrated to GH’s Port Charles over the years are Tamara Braun, (Ava Vitali) who played two roles on GH, and  Denise Alexander (Susan Hunter Martin).

A Years-Long History Of Actor Migration Between The Two Soaps

Stephen Nichols, (Steve Johnson) Mary Beth Evans, (Kayla Johnson) Thaao Penghlis (Andre and Tony DiMera) and Charles Shaughnessy (Shane and Drew Donovan) have also been on both shows.

So with that years-long history of actors traveling back and forth between the two soaps, Carson should certainly have his agent reach out to the ABC soap.

Viewers who watch both of the shows over the years have remarked on the similarities of the two shows-hospitals being major employers in the two fictional cities, as well as main families.

Thaao Penghis and Charles Shaughnessy seamlessly transformed from DiMeras to GH’s Cassadines, and Wally Kurth’s DOOL Kiriakis family is similar to GH’s Quartermaines. Oh, and let’s not forget mad scientists and returns from the dead!
